12×12 Art Show & Sale
The 19th annual 12×12 Art Show & Sale is coming up in the next couple weeks. The event on September 20th will showcase 150 Oklahoma artists working within the parameters of twelve-by-twelve-inches and will help raise money for the art scene in Oklahoma. Over $60k was raised at this event last year.
